Comunidad de diseño web y desarrollo en internet online

Tutorial de Javascript y Flash

Citar            
MensajeEscrito el 22 Ago 2006 03:52 pm
Basandome en el tutorial de "Flash con otros lenguajes - Parte 1, JavaScript" escrito por Freddie® y en el tutorial sobre AJAX "Tutorial de AJAX (Asynchronous Javascript and XML)" de Sisco, he intentado crear un menu en flash que controle una Web HTML que use AJAX. Pero no entiendo porque no funciona si lo unico que hago es:

    Sustituir los parametros pasados por el fscommand para que se correspondan con el div y el html a cargar.


    Cambiar la funcion "alert" del primer tutorial por la "llamarasincrono(parametro1,parametro2)" del segundo.


Al clikar en el boton mientras que en Firefox ni se inmuta, en IE me sale un error de pagina debido a un acceso denegado.

El codigo del boton flash es:

Código :

on (release) {
   fscommand("'inicio.htm'", "'contenido");
}


Donde contenido es el ID del div donde quiero cargar el htm.

El del javascript no cambia nada de los tutoriales salvo la linea 6 del primer tutorial sustituyendo el alert por:

Código :

llamarasincrono(command,args);





Si pudieran ayudarme les estaria muy agradecida. :oops:

Por Lulu

11 de clabLevel



 

firefox
Citar            
MensajeEscrito el 23 Ago 2006 06:32 pm
puedes llamar a una function javascript desde actionscrip desde un

Código :

txt.htmlText = "<a href='javascript:nombreFunction'><font color='#66CC33'>Ver mas...</font></a>  ";

o desde un boton:

Código :

on (press){
   link = "inscripcion.php";
   ancho = 770;
   alto = 575;
   getURL ("javascript:void(window.open('"+link+"','_blank'))");
}

Por micheloud

341 de clabLevel



 

Misiones, Argentina

firefox
Citar            
MensajeEscrito el 23 Ago 2006 11:38 pm
No consigo hacer que funcione de esa manera :(. Muchas gracias por la ayuda :).

Por Lulu

11 de clabLevel



 

firefox
Citar            
MensajeEscrito el 24 Ago 2006 10:51 am
te aclaro que tienes que tener preparada la función javascript, ahi yo unicamente te mostre dos maneras de llamar desde AS a funciones javascript.
Desde donde llamas al javascript? (boton, mc, un texto html) y... que debe hacer el javascript?

Por micheloud

341 de clabLevel



 

Misiones, Argentina

firefox
Citar            
MensajeEscrito el 24 Ago 2006 11:55 am
hola, tu pones:

Código :

on (release) {
   fscommand("'inicio.htm'", "'contenido");
}


Prueba:

Código :

on (release) {
getURL("javascript:llamarasincrono(" + inicio.htm + " , " + contenido + ")");   
}


Pero no tengo experiencia, ya que no es javascript sino asíncrono javascript. Así que no sé si funcionará.

Suerte!

Por Sisco

BOFH

3700 de clabLevel

12 tutoriales
4 articulos

Genero:Masculino   Bastard Operators From Hell

Catalunya

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.